Brake's Stress is reduced.
This is a change from OEM horizontal placement 11mm to 5/8Radial master.
Because it seemed to interfere with the Switch box, the Lever was changed to Eukanaya's (NI002-049),
Nisshin's Tank Bracket (49151) for Separate Handlebars is installed.
As for the banjo fitting, a stainless steel mesh hose (AC Performance line) compatible with the car model was originally installed, but it interfered with the switch wiring, so an L-shaped adapter was used to make an escape.
My impression after installation is that the absolute braking force has not changed, but the controllability has improved.
Specifically, it is an Image with interpolated increments of braking force according to the strength of the grip.
The beginning of the grip is especially noticeable. With the horizontal 11mm pad, the rise in braking force is abrupt, but with the vertical pad, there is a sense of being able to adjust the strength of the pad. The same is true near the end of the grip, making it easier to generate strong braking force without locking.
Probably because the lever ratio and diameter are designed to match the weight of a horizontally mounted 11mm lever, it will not be that uncomfortable (too effective or too ineffective) to replace it. If you want a lighter grip or more strokes, you may want to consider a 14mm or 15mm model such as the F Land-.
In general, I can recommend it, but since it is Large strange to do banjo fitting by yourself, it is safer to ask a supply store with a Pit.

Material:Material on the Caliper side of Aluminum:Banjo bolt in Aluminum.
Since the caliper side is aluminum, we replaced the OEM steel banjo bolt with an aluminum banjo bolt to prevent thread galling due to electrical corrosion when replacing the brake hose.
Since it is GOODRIDGE compatible, OEM's NORMAL could be used, but replaced with this product for the above reasons.
Since it is a product of a proper manufacturer, there are no problems with thread accuracy, quality of anodized processing, etc., and it can be used with confidence.

Air Free Banjo Bolt is the only choice on the MASTER side, even if it is expensive!
When I have owned a vehicle for more than 20 years with a disc brake, I always change the banjo bolt on the MASTER side to an air-free type when I replace the brake hose with a mesh type because the difficulty level when bleeding air is reduced by a large amount.
I was able to easily pull out the Air that is stuck in the MASTER side, which is difficult to pull out, and the work time was reduced to a LARGE width.

Sufficient braking power even at low cost
Purchased Repeat for PCX150KF30 Stock.
The first time (approx. 18,000 km) I replaced the Golden Pad by Company D. The second time (approx. 32,000 km) I replaced it with this one because of the price, and I am satisfied with the braking power and control.
I don't do any Sports driving with my PCX150 and feel it is sufficient as it is a consumable item.
The photo shows the current condition after about 4,000 km of driving after replacement, and there is plenty of Pad left.
It is enough if it lasts 10,000 to 15,000 km, so it would be helpful if the replacement is inexpensive for this level of cycles.
